About Noto Sans Modi

Modi is a cursive script historically used in Maharashtra, India, primarily for administrative and commercial records from roughly the 12th century until the early 20th century. This Noto face covers the Unicode Modi block, rendering the script's flowing, joined letterforms with the accuracy needed for historical document transcription and scholarly publication. It serves archivists, historians of Marathi literature, and digital humanities projects digitizing the vast body of Modi-script manuscripts held in Indian libraries.
